QUICK START GUIDE FOR DEMONSTRATION CIRCUIT 1388A 3A QUIESCENT CURRENT, 20mA LINEAR REGULATOR LT3008EDC DESCRIPTION Demonstration circuit 1388A is an ultralow quiescent current and low dropout voltage linear regulator featuring LT(R)3008, which comes in an 8-lead TSOT23 or 2mmX2mm DFN package. The DC1388A has an input voltage range from 2V to 45V, and is capable of delivering up to 20mA output current. With the 3A quiescent current of the LT3008, the DC1388A is ideal for supplying power to low current batterypowered systems, keep-alive power supply and remote monitoring utility meters and hotel door locks. Refer to Figure 1. for proper measurement equipment setup and following the procedures below: 1. Before proceeding to test, insert jumper JP1 into the OFF position, and use VOUT Select jumper J1 for the desired output voltage 1.2V, 1.8V, 2.0V, 2.5V, 3.3V or 5.0V. If the output voltage is different from the above values, use the USER option and install a resistor R8. Select R8 according to the following equation: R8 = VOUT -1 619K . 0.6V Assume 1.2V is the desired output for the following evaluations. 1 QUICK START GUIDE FOR DEMONSTRATION CIRCUIT 1388A 3A QUIESCENT CURRENT, 20mA LINEAR REGULATOR 2. Apply 2V across Vin (to Gnd). Insert jumper JP1 into the ON position. Draw 20mA of load current. The measured Vout should be 1.2V 3% (1.164V to 1.236V). 3. Vary the input voltage from 2V to 45V and the load current from no load to 20mA. Vout should measure 1.2V 3% (1.164V to 1.236V). Figure 1. Proper Measurement Equipment Setup Figure 2.
